CBS’ The Late Show with Stephen Colbert is going live tonight to cover President Donald Trump’s address to the joint session of Congress, with the help of former Obama White House Press Secretary Josh Earnest. But over at ABC, Jimmy Kimmel has just declared a “Trump-Free Tuesday” for Jimmy Kimmel Live!

With most of the past two years dominated by Trump talk, Kimmel announced a much-needed break from discussing the president and his administration — at least for one night.

That won’t be hard to accomplish, what with tonight’s show including Chris Pratt debuting the trailer for his upcoming sequel Guardians of the Galaxy Vol 2, as well as guests Catherine Zeta-Jones from FX’s Feud, NBA All-Star James Harden and music from Hank “The Hawk” Knutley.
